A tragic airplane crash in Colorado claimed the lives of a Florida couple just days after they were married in Telluride.

Costas Sivyllis and Lindsey Vogelaar were killed in October when their private plane crashed in the Ingram Basin, east of Telluride, according to a local NBC News affiliate. The National Transit Safety Board is investigating the crash, which occurred some 10 to 15 minutes after takeoff. 

Vogelaar, a Denver native who worked in the airline industry, and Sivyllis were headed back to their home in Central Florida at the time of the accident. Sivyllis was a licensed pilot and flight instructor. 

“They had eloped to Telluride for a small wedding and adventure-filled honeymoon that they were documenting online for friends and families to follow,” the San Miguel Sheriff’s office told CBSN Denver.

Legal Rights for the Family of People Killed in Colorado Accidents

When a person dies in a plane, car, truck, or other accident in Colorado, his or her family has the right to seek compensation from those responsible. That usually happens by filing a claim for wrongful death

No amount of money can ever replace a loved one or allow you to go back in time and stop an accident from happening. Money damages can, however, ease much of the financial strain that can come with the loss of a loved one.

Airplane accidents raise a number of potential liability issues. Often, these crashes are caused by poor design or defective or malfunctioning equipment. The plane’s manufacturer and parts makers may be liable if you can show that a defect or other problem caused or contributed to the crash.

In crashes involving commercial airlines, the company that owns and operates the plane is often to blame. Air carriers are liable for mistakes made by pilots and other employees, as well as in situations in which they fail to properly inspect and maintain their planes.
